ζeh Matt
d8ce486fa4
Merge remote-tracking branch 'upstream/develop' into new-save-format
2021-09-27 23:13:49 +03:00
ζeh Matt
6fcd224efd
Merge pull request #15473 from ZehMatt/backport/nsf-paintsetup
...
Use CoordsXY for sprite_paint_setup
2021-09-27 13:10:19 -07:00
ζeh Matt
4ea8902587
Refactor arg passing to sprite_paint_setup
2021-09-27 22:48:06 +03:00
ζeh Matt
cecf4ac202
Use CoordsXY for sprite_paint_setup
...
Co-authored-by: Ted John <ted@brambles.org >
2021-09-27 22:47:36 +03:00
duncanspumpkin
1d788030ca
Revert mistaken rename
2021-09-27 12:35:03 +01:00
Gymnasiast
ea4c9681b5
Revert stray changes
2021-09-26 20:00:42 +02:00
Gymnasiast
8f97730a5e
Merge remote-tracking branch 'upstream/develop' into new-save-format
2021-09-26 19:56:04 +02:00
Michael Steenbeek
f7d61c67e6
Fix arbitrary ride type cheat not working
2021-09-26 16:21:34 +02:00
Gymnasiast
0825865d13
Merge remote-tracking branch 'upstream/develop' into new-save-format
2021-09-26 11:57:32 +02:00
Gymnasiast
e4d6cd3c34
Revert stray changes to openrct2.d.ts
2021-09-26 11:54:06 +02:00
Hielke Morsink
9dd9b27db4
Make WIDGETS_END constexpr
2021-09-26 11:11:42 +02:00
Gymnasiast
a9ba0fce9d
Fix track element ride type on import
...
Not yet tested because of other import errors.
2021-09-25 22:54:06 +02:00
seanmajorpayne
2ba515fb37
Improve #15322 : Circus Music Not Playing
...
Alleviates the issue, though the circus in European Extravaganza still does not work correctly.
2021-09-25 19:21:38 +00:00
Hielke Morsink
5d2a367249
Merge branch 'develop' into new-save-format
2021-09-25 12:28:42 +02:00
Michael Steenbeek
1feac16bed
Merge pull request #15414 from frutiemax/develop
...
#15367 : Encode RideType in TrackElement
2021-09-25 12:02:08 +02:00
Hielke Morsink
a8b84989eb
Check for nullptr explicitly in operct2-ui ( #15460 )
2021-09-25 08:45:06 +02:00
Hielke Morsink
53c22c9b4b
Check for nullptr explicitly ( #15458 )
2021-09-24 20:05:50 +02:00
Gymnasiast
d9ca8a130f
Remove accidentally committed statement
2021-09-23 22:24:44 +02:00
ζeh Matt
f689b4e4c8
Merge remote-tracking branch 'upstream/develop' into new-save-format
2021-09-23 22:28:17 +03:00
ζeh Matt
e5de2adc4f
Merge pull request #15429 from ZehMatt/backport/ticks
...
Remove scenario ticks and adjust export/import
2021-09-23 12:08:16 -07:00
ζeh Matt
7302cb806a
Update replays
2021-09-23 21:49:09 +03:00
ζeh Matt
c61f141cdc
Bump up network version
2021-09-23 21:49:09 +03:00
ζeh Matt
74e8988dd8
Remove scenario ticks and adjust export/import
...
Co-authored-by: Ted John <ted@brambles.org >
2021-09-23 21:49:09 +03:00
ζeh Matt
719a5a9d8e
Merge pull request #15369 from ZehMatt/refactor/tile-coords
...
Refactor overload map_get_first_element_at
2021-09-21 14:36:03 -07:00
Hielke Morsink
9060a0d228
Add missing headers to VS project file ( #15457 )
2021-09-21 23:34:33 +02:00
Duncan
a268350615
Fix #15439 : Ride viewport is partially grey
...
The ride viewport does not work the same as other viewports due to the selection of views that it has. After refactoring the focus system to use a more streamlined approach the ride viewport lost its invalidation on resizing. If the ride window was to use the same viewport update code as say the guest window then the viewport focus still ends up incorrect due to it no longer centring the focus. Therefore the best approach was to lose the focus on resize and force a recalculation of it.
Also renamed Focus2 to Focus as Focus2 was meant to just be fill in whilst removing the original focus structs.
2021-09-21 11:06:04 +02:00
Gymnasiast
8fb8b2a4c1
Do not overwrite ride type when extending station
2021-09-21 10:50:38 +02:00
Gymnasiast
11607f525d
const auto&
2021-09-21 10:49:29 +02:00
Gymnasiast
1e17304e76
Show the appropriate ride type in the TI
2021-09-21 10:49:29 +02:00
Gymnasiast
f21b941b46
Introduce ride_type_t
2021-09-21 10:49:29 +02:00
frutiemax
355019f97f
#15367 : Encode RideType in TrackElement
2021-09-21 10:49:28 +02:00
Gymnasiast
6280152c9c
Merge remote-tracking branch 'upstream/develop' into new-save-format
2021-09-21 10:36:26 +02:00
ζeh Matt
c56810e6a5
Fix #15442 : Use after free in object manager
2021-09-21 10:34:58 +02:00
OpenRCT2 git bot
fddf009afc
Merge Localisation/master into OpenRCT2/develop
2021-09-21 04:08:19 +00:00
Hielke Morsink
30b8f2e5a9
Merge pull request #15441 from OpenRCT2/janisozaur-patch-1
2021-09-19 23:03:40 +02:00
Michał Janiszewski
a37c8539e7
Fix bounds check in Litter::GetName
2021-09-19 22:38:25 +02:00
ζeh Matt
6a1dbb9268
Merge pull request #15438 from Broxzier/feature/nsf-issue
...
Add 'new save format' as option for issue area
2021-09-19 12:01:35 -07:00
Hielke Morsink
3eaf1d4300
Add 'new save format' as option for issue area
2021-09-19 20:41:10 +02:00
Hielke Morsink
d3f7660a46
Use min/max water height defines in mapgen
2021-09-19 17:18:23 +02:00
duncanspumpkin
75d1b9402c
Revert mistaken rename
...
The park file has a function of the same name and during a rename exercise this unrelated function was accidentally renamed
2021-09-19 07:33:09 +01:00
duncanspumpkin
028fb83d17
Remove duplicated check
...
This is performed in the query and does not need to be in the execute. This was already removed in develop
2021-09-19 07:28:13 +01:00
duncanspumpkin
63b075695e
Merge branch 'develop' into HEAD
2021-09-19 07:20:35 +01:00
Duncan
938792e6be
Use CoordsXYZ for ride view ( #15434 )
...
* Use CoordsXYZ for ride view
Part of the NSF but also took the time to refactor slightly to use the more appropriate types. Annoyingly there isn't a operator/ for CoordsXYZ otherwise this could have been further simplified.
* Fix missed minx/maxx occurrence
Co-authored-by: Michael Steenbeek <m.o.steenbeek@gmail.com >
2021-09-19 07:19:32 +01:00
OpenRCT2 git bot
99e3883b6e
Merge Localisation/master into OpenRCT2/develop
2021-09-19 04:07:58 +00:00
Gymnasiast
f605a55b49
Fix footpaths in RCT1 parks (merge error)
2021-09-18 22:56:18 +02:00
duncanspumpkin
d9a188bcba
Merge branch 'develop' into HEAD
2021-09-18 21:31:46 +01:00
Duncan
81051f2d21
Add crypt files from NSF
2021-09-18 20:31:23 +00:00
duncanspumpkin
ddbc674fe9
Merge branch 'develop' into HEAD
2021-09-18 20:57:59 +01:00
Duncan
fa57b6aea0
Remove focus union and replace with typed focus ( #15426 )
...
* Remove focus union and replace with typed focus
This if for the NSF to allow for CoordsXYZ
* Remove legacy structures
* Rework viewport_create to deduplicate logic
* Simplify yet further
* Apply review comments
* Remove intermediate
2021-09-18 20:34:38 +01:00
duncanspumpkin
664dd4386c
Merge branch 'develop' into HEAD
2021-09-18 19:09:46 +01:00